Use the Right Databases
Selecting the correct databases can be a crucial A part of building scalable purposes. Not all databases are created the identical, and using the Completely wrong you can sluggish you down or perhaps cause failures as your application grows.
Begin by understanding your facts. Is it really structured, like rows in the table? If Certainly, a relational databases like PostgreSQL or MySQL is an efficient fit. These are typically robust with relationships, transactions, and consistency. In addition they assist scaling methods like examine replicas, indexing, and partitioning to deal with much more targeted visitors and info.
If your knowledge is more versatile—like person activity logs, product or service catalogs, or documents—look at a NoSQL selection like MongoDB, Cassandra, or DynamoDB. NoSQL databases are better at dealing with significant volumes of unstructured or semi-structured info and will scale horizontally much more simply.
Also, consider your read through and generate patterns. Are you carrying out many reads with fewer writes? Use caching and browse replicas. Will you be handling a large produce load? Look into databases that will cope with high publish throughput, or simply event-based mostly knowledge storage units like Apache Kafka (for temporary info streams).
It’s also sensible to Assume in advance. You might not want State-of-the-art scaling options now, but choosing a database that supports them indicates you gained’t want to change later on.
Use indexing to hurry up queries. Prevent avoidable joins. Normalize or denormalize your information according to your entry designs. And constantly keep an eye on databases effectiveness when you improve.
To put it briefly, the ideal databases depends on your app’s composition, velocity requires, And exactly how you hope it to mature. Acquire time to select correctly—it’ll preserve plenty of issues later on.
Enhance Code and Queries
Quickly code is key to scalability. As your app grows, each individual compact hold off adds up. Poorly written code or unoptimized queries can decelerate effectiveness and overload your system. That’s why it’s important to Establish successful logic from the start.
Begin by crafting cleanse, basic code. Stay away from repeating logic and remove just about anything unwanted. Don’t pick the most intricate Answer if a straightforward one particular operates. Keep the features brief, concentrated, and simple to test. Use profiling instruments to discover bottlenecks—areas exactly where your code usually takes way too lengthy to operate or makes use of too much memory.
Following, take a look at your databases queries. These frequently gradual items down over the code alone. Ensure each query only asks for the info you actually have to have. Stay away from Find *, which fetches every little thing, and instead pick unique fields. Use indexes more info to hurry up lookups. And avoid undertaking a lot of joins, Particularly throughout large tables.
Should you see exactly the same facts being requested time and again, use caching. Store the final results temporarily making use of instruments like Redis or Memcached so you don’t must repeat high priced functions.
Also, batch your databases operations once you can. In place of updating a row one after the other, update them in teams. This cuts down on overhead and tends to make your application extra efficient.
Remember to check with massive datasets. Code and queries that do the job fine with 100 information may well crash whenever they have to manage one million.
To put it briefly, scalable apps are quickly applications. Maintain your code restricted, your queries lean, and use caching when wanted. These techniques assistance your software continue to be sleek and responsive, at the same time as the load increases.
Leverage Load Balancing and Caching
As your app grows, it's got to handle a lot more end users and a lot more website traffic. If anything goes as a result of a person server, it will eventually immediately turn into a bottleneck. That’s wherever load balancing and caching can be found in. Both of these equipment aid maintain your app quickly, stable, and scalable.
Load balancing spreads incoming visitors throughout various servers. In lieu of just one server executing every one of the operate, the load balancer routes consumers to various servers based on availability. This suggests no one server receives overloaded. If one particular server goes down, the load balancer can deliver traffic to the Many others. Instruments like Nginx, HAProxy, or cloud-based mostly options from AWS and Google Cloud make this straightforward to build.
Caching is about storing knowledge temporarily so it might be reused speedily. When customers ask for a similar facts once more—like an item website page or even a profile—you don’t need to fetch it with the database when. It is possible to serve it with the cache.
There are 2 popular forms of caching:
1. Server-facet caching (like Redis or Memcached) retailers data in memory for rapidly access.
two. Client-aspect caching (like browser caching or CDN caching) stores static documents close to the consumer.
Caching cuts down database load, increases speed, and would make your app extra productive.
Use caching for things which don’t alter generally. And usually ensure that your cache is updated when knowledge does change.
In a nutshell, load balancing and caching are very simple but effective instruments. Together, they help your application manage additional users, remain rapid, and recover from difficulties. If you propose to grow, you will need both equally.
Use Cloud and Container Tools
To construct scalable apps, you would like tools that let your app grow very easily. That’s the place cloud platforms and containers are available. They offer you flexibility, decrease setup time, and make scaling Considerably smoother.
Cloud platforms like Amazon World-wide-web Services (AWS), Google Cloud Platform (GCP), and Microsoft Azure let you rent servers and providers as you may need them. You don’t should invest in components or guess potential capability. When targeted traffic boosts, you could increase extra resources with just a few clicks or automatically using auto-scaling. When traffic drops, you are able to scale down to save money.
These platforms also offer services like managed databases, storage, load balancing, and security applications. You could concentrate on developing your app in lieu of running infrastructure.
Containers are A different critical Device. A container packages your app and all the things it ought to operate—code, libraries, settings—into one device. This causes it to be straightforward to move your application concerning environments, from the laptop computer towards the cloud, without surprises. Docker is the preferred Device for this.
When your application employs several containers, tools like Kubernetes make it easier to deal with them. Kubernetes handles deployment, scaling, and recovery. If a person portion of one's application crashes, it restarts it routinely.
Containers also allow it to be easy to different areas of your application into companies. You are able to update or scale pieces independently, that's perfect for functionality and reliability.
Briefly, utilizing cloud and container applications implies you can scale rapidly, deploy easily, and Get well quickly when troubles happen. If you prefer your app to improve with out boundaries, start employing these applications early. They preserve time, lower danger, and make it easier to stay focused on constructing, not correcting.
Keep track of Anything
If you don’t check your software, you received’t know when things go Improper. Checking assists you see how your application is accomplishing, spot concerns early, and make greater conclusions as your application grows. It’s a important Portion of making scalable units.
Begin by tracking standard metrics like CPU utilization, memory, disk Place, and reaction time. These show you how your servers and services are performing. Equipment like Prometheus, Grafana, Datadog, or New Relic will let you collect and visualize this information.
Don’t just check your servers—keep an eye on your app way too. Control just how long it will require for people to load internet pages, how frequently faults materialize, and where by they manifest. Logging tools like ELK Stack (Elasticsearch, Logstash, Kibana) or Loggly can help you see what’s happening within your code.
Arrange alerts for vital complications. Such as, In the event your response time goes above a Restrict or simply a company goes down, you'll want to get notified promptly. This can help you correct troubles quickly, frequently prior to users even see.
Checking is additionally helpful when you make changes. When you deploy a whole new characteristic and see a spike in faults or slowdowns, you may roll it back again before it leads to serious hurt.
As your app grows, targeted visitors and facts boost. Without checking, you’ll skip indications of difficulties till it’s much too late. But with the best tools set up, you stay on top of things.
In brief, checking aids you keep the app responsible and scalable. It’s not nearly recognizing failures—it’s about knowing your system and making certain it works very well, even under pressure.
